Verdict
Not a strong race by any stretch of the imagination and this looks a good opportunity for Kanga to open her account against exposed rivals. The TEAMtalk selection showed the benefit of her initial start when a close second of 15 over this trip at Redcar earlier in the month and, with further improvement anticipated, should prove hard to beat at this level. Vincentia has had plenty of chances and is no better than selling class but still has place claims here while Storm Clear flopped last time in handicap company but will appreciate the drop in grade and should pose the main threat if able to reproduce the form of placed efforts earlier in the season.
